About this wine

The 2011 growing season surpassed the 2010 for lack of heat and still holds the record for coldest season in recent history.  Fruitfulness is determined in the previous year, however, so the cool 2010 spring resulted in very low yields for 2011.  This was in our favour, as the vine had less “work” to do in this cooler year, so the fruit ripened nicely, had extremely long hang-times. This provided us with a lovely, elegant blend. Barrel matured for 16 months in small French oak (46% new).
